titleOfInvention | Preparation method of cellulose membrane humidity response exciter |
abstract | The invention discloses a method for preparing a cellulose membrane humidity response exciter, which comprises the steps of firstly, carrying out chemical reagent treatment on natural wood to extract lignin and hemicellulose in the wood; then, carrying out freeze drying and tabletting treatment on the wood; finally, annealing the wood to prepare the cellulose membrane humidity response exciter. The invention is simple and environment-friendly, the prepared exciter has low price, is recyclable, is environment-friendly, has better humidity responsiveness, can generate various preset mechanical deformations through structural design, and the prepared three-claw gripper can grip 0.62 g of heavy objects, which is 40 times of the total weight of the three claws. |
